Default B20v Running Too Rich! *Need Help ASAP*

So I have a fresh b20v swap in my EM1. Runs okay, starts right up. Just running too rich. It only sputters on WOT. If you don't push it to the floor, it'll rev up like its supposed to.
Took out the spark plugs, all plugs from cylinder #1-4 are black. (Brand new NGK Sparkplugs)
I cleaned them out with sandpaper and threw them back in the car then let the car run for a minute. Right when I took out #1plug, it looked black as before.
Could it be my O2 sensor??
I have DC headers so I don't have the primary O2 sensor, just the secondary O2 on the cat.
The only codes I have are:
P0108 Manifold Absolute Pressure/BARO Sensor High Input
P0122 Throttle/Pedal Position Sensor A Circuit Low Input
P1337 CKP (CKF) Sensor No Signal <------Running b20v in a stock 00 civic SI harness (OBD2) I can bypass it if I put my OBD1 Jumper and run a stock PR3 ECU
O2 Sensor Code <---Don't remember what the code was (Car is in paint booth)

Default Re: B20v Running Too Rich! *Need Help ASAP*

Check that the plugs for the MAP and TPS are not swapped. The plug where one of the wires is solid white goes on the MAP. Good idea to check all the sensor plugs by wire color as well. Check that the TPS voltage increases as throttle is opened. Some swaps require reversing the two outside wires.

The system needs a primary O2 sensor. Modify the header so there is a place to mount one.
